![Xilinx Zynq UltraScale+ ZCU208 User Manual Download Page 31](http://html1.mh-extra.com/html/xilinx/zynq-ultrascale-zcu208/zynq-ultrascale-zcu208_user-manual_3499071031.webp)
Table 3: Command List (cont'd)
Command
Input Parameters
Output Parameters
Description
SetThresholdSettings
Tile, Block,
ThresholdSettings.UpdateThreshold,
ThresholdSettings.ThresholdMode[0],
ThresholdSettings.ThresholdMode[1],
ThresholdSettings.ThresholdAvgVal[0],
ThresholdSettings.ThresholdAvgVal[1],
ThresholdSettings.ThresholdUnderVal[
0],
ThresholdSettings.ThresholdUnderVal[
1],
ThresholdSettings.ThresholdOverVal[0],
ThresholdSettings.ThresholdOverVal[1]
None
Cf. PG269
SetSignalDetector
Tile, Block, Mode, TimeConstant, Flush,
EnableIntegrator, Threshold,
ThreshOnTriggerCnt,
ThreshOffTriggerCnt, HysteresisEnable
Tile, Block
Cf. PG269
SetupFIFO
Type, Tile, Enable
None
Cf. PG269
SetupFIFOObs
Type, Tile, Enable
None
Cf. PG269
Shutdown
Type, Tile
None
Cf. PG269
StartUp
Type, Tile
None
Cf. PG269
CustomStartup
Type, Tile, StartState, EndState
None
Cf. PG269
UpdateEvent
Type, Tile, Block, Event
None
Cf. PG269
DynamicPLLConfig
Type, Tile, Source, RefClkFreq,
SamplingRate
RefClkDivider, FeedbackDivider, OutputDivider
Cf. PG269
MultiBand
Type, Tile, DigitalDataPathMask,
DataType, DataConverterMask
Type, Tile, DigitalDataPathMask, DataType, DataConverterMask
Cf. PG269
SetCalCoefficients
Tile, Block, CalBlock, Coeffs.Coeff0,
Coeffs.Coeff1, Coeffs.Coeff2,
Coeffs.Coeff3, Coeffs.Coeff4,
Coeffs.Coeff5, Coeffs.Coeff6,
Coeffs.Coeff7
None
Cf. PG269
GetCalCoefficients
Tile, Block, CalBlock
Tile, Block, CalBlock, Coeffs.Coeff0, Coeffs.Coeff1, Coeffs.Coeff2, Coeffs.Coeff3,
Coeffs.Coeff4, Coeffs.Coeff5, Coeffs.Coeff6, Coeffs.Coeff7
Cf. PG269
DisableCoefficientsOverride
Tile, Block, CalBlock
None
Cf. PG269
SetDACCompMode
Tile, Block, Enable
Tile, Block, Enable
Cf. PG269
GetEnabledInterrupts
Type, Tile, Block
Type, Tile, Block, IntrMask
Cf. PG269
SetDACDataScaler
Tile, Block, Enabled
None
Cf. PG269
GetDACDataScaler
Tile, Block
Tile, Block, Enabled
Cf. PG269
Board Control Commands
GetExtPllConfig
Board_id, Pll_src
Freq
Return the current
frequency of the LMX.
GetExtParentClkList
Board_id
LMK_FREQ_LIST[LMK_FREQ_NUM]
Return a list of
frequencies available
for the LMK.
GetExtParentClkConfig
Board_id
LMKCurrentFreq
Return the current
LMK frequency.
GetExtPllFreqList
Board_id, Pll_src
ADC_FREQ_LIST[LMX_ADC_NUM] or DAC_FREQ_LIST[LMX_DAC_NUM]
depending on Pll_Src
Return a list of
allowed values for the
LMX.
RfclkReadReg
Board_id, chip_id, reg_addr
Board_id, chip_id, reg_addr, data
Read a register from
the LMK/LMX.
RfclkWriteReg
Board_id, chip_id, reg_addr, data
Board_id, chip_id, reg_addr, data
Write a register from
the LMK/LMX with the
following parameters:
Board_id (always 0)
chip_id ( 0 :PLL ADC, 1
PLL DAC, 2: LMK)
reg_addr (register
address from the TCS
file)
data (data from the
TCS file)
SetExtParentclk
Board_id, freq
Board_id, freq
Configure LMK clock
with requested
frequency.
SetExtPllClkRate
Board_id, Pll_src, freq
Board_id, Pll_Src, freq
Configure PLL (LMX)
with requested
frequency.
Appendix B: Command List
UG1433 (v1.2) October 27, 2021
RF Data Converter Evaluation Tool User Guide
31